Story summary
  • The Chicago Bears focus on improving their tight end position ahead of the 2026 NFL Draft after Durham Smythe's departure.
  • The Bears are evaluating Sam Roush (Stanford) for his blocking ability.
  • The Bears are evaluating Nate Boerkircher (Texas A&M) for his versatility.
  • The Bears view Keldric Faulk (Auburn) as a potential pick to add defensive flexibility, though pass-rush concerns exist.
  • The draft's unpredictability could significantly influence the Bears' strategy.
